Amanda Rubin
Trustee
After graduating in 1988 with a First Class BA (Hons) in Communication Studies and Sociology from London University, Goldsmiths College, Amanda pursued a successful career for ten years as a freelance Television documentary Producer/Director, winning awards for films shown on BBC and Channel 4, including 2 ‘Cutting Edge’ documentaries, films for The Late Show, Rough Guides and Channel 4 Schools. She later taught on the television production course at Goldsmiths, before studying Homeopathy at The Centre for Homeopathic Education. She graduated in 2005, and began working at Viveka, an Integrated Clinic in London, alongside a team of doctors and complimentary practitioners under the guidance of leading obstetrician/gynaecologist Yehudi Gordon. She also worked closely with the Birth Unit at St John and Elizabeth Hospital, helping to facilitate the Midwife Training course, and initiating a Homeopathy Course for Pharmacists from Boots Pharmacies in NW London.
In 2008 Amanda helped to form the media/pr group 4Homeopathy, whose first project, a ‘Communications Toolkit for Homeopaths’ with Nelsons Pharmacy, was widely favorably received. She was involved in the early stages of the HMC:21 “Homeopathy Worked for Me” petition campaign, and is currently working alongside various groups to promote homeopathy in the media. She is presently developing an ambitious Photography Project with high-profile celebrities.

Francis Treuherz MA RSHom FSHom
Trustee
I have been in practice since 1984 (and part time in the NHS from 1990-2003). I have been a Trustee since this charity was founded. I am a Fellow of the Society of Homeopaths, former editor of the journal, and former Hon Secretary. I taught homeopathy at the University of Westminster, and also at Amsterdam, Chichester, Galway, Helsinki, London, Manchester, Prague, San José, San Francisco, Seattle, Stockholm ... . I live and work in NW London. Homeopathy has definitely arrived in the 21st century - over 1000 of the latest and classic homeopathic literature may be accessed from a computer program which I help to edit.The Society of Homeopaths has published an informative survey of my work with 500 NHS patients – ask for a copy. I have written many articles and a book. I have a vast personal library on every aspect of homeopathy.
